318 engine build

I'd take Rumblefish up on his manifold swap. The LD4B is designed for the smaller 273/318 intake ports. With the low compression, the engine won't tolerate a lot of whoopee on the cam and be decent to drive on the street.

You can gain a little compression by using the thinest head gasket you can find. Using pistons from a 67-70 318 will also help.
